The global venous thromboembolism treatment market is set for significant growth, with the market size valued at USD 1.05 billion in 2023 and projected to reach USD 2.13 billion by 2032. This robust expansion repres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.50% over the forecast period from 2024 to 2032, driven by increasing incidence rates of VTE, advancements in treatment options, and rising awareness of the condition.
Venous thromboembolism refers to the formation of blood clots in the veins, typically manifesting as deep vein thrombosis (DVT) or pulmonary embolism (PE). Both conditions pose serious health risks, and without prompt treatment, VTE can lead to long-term complications or death. The growing focus on early diagnosis and more effective treatment protocols is driving demand for VTE treatment solutions.

Key Market Drivers

  1. Rising Prevalence of Venous Thromboembolism: The global incidence of venous thromboembolism continues to rise, largely due to an aging population and increasing prevalence of risk factors such as obesity, cancer, and sedentary lifestyles. VTE remains a major cause of preventable hospital deaths, driving the need for effective treatment options. As the number of at-risk patients grows, so does the demand for advanced therapeutic solutions to manage and treat the condition.

  2. Advancements in Anticoagulant Therapies: Significant progress has been made in the development of anticoagulant drugs, a key treatment for VTE. Newer classes of direct oral anticoagulants (DOACs) such as apixaban, rivaroxaban, and edoxaban offer improved safety profiles, ease of administration, and reduced monitoring compared to traditional anticoagulants like warfarin. These innovations are enhancing patient compliance and improving outcomes, contributing to market growth.

  3. Increased Awareness and Screening: Rising awareness of venous thromboembolism, particularly in hospital and post-operative settings, is contributing to earlier diagnosis and treatment. Efforts by healthcare organizations to improve VTE prevention strategies, including routine screening for high-risk patients, are driving demand for treatment solutions. Public health campaigns and education initiatives are also helping to increase recognition of the symptoms and risks associated with VTE.

  4. Technological Advancements in Diagnostics: Advances in imaging technologies and diagnostic tools are playing a crucial role in the early detection and monitoring of VTE. Improved diagnostic capabilities, such as D-dimer blood tests, ultrasound, and advanced imaging techniques like CT angiography, enable healthcare providers to identify clots more accurately and initiate timely treatment. The use of AI-driven diagnostic tools also offers the potential to further improve VTE detection and patient outcomes.

  5. Rising Incidence of Cancer-Associated Thrombosis: Cancer patients are at a significantly higher risk of developing venous thromboembolism, known as cancer-associated thrombosis (CAT). As cancer rates continue to rise globally, so too does the demand for VTE treatment options tailored to oncology patients. The growing focus on managing CAT is expected to drive further demand for anticoagulant therapies and other treatment modalities over the coming years.

Challenges and Opportunities
While the VTE treatment market is growing, it also faces challenges such as the potential side effects of anticoagulant therapies, including bleeding complications. This concern has spurred ongoing research and development efforts to create safer anticoagulant drugs with lower bleeding risks, presenting opportunities for pharmaceutical companies to innovate and capture market share.
In addition, the high cost of advanced treatment options, especially in low- and middle-income countries, may limit market growth. However, increasing healthcare access, expanding insurance coverage, and global health initiatives aimed at reducing VTE incidence are likely to mitigate these barriers in the coming years.
Regional Insights
North America currently dominates the venous thromboembolism treatment market, driven by its advanced healthcare infrastructure, high disease awareness, and the availability of innovative treatment options. The region’s focus on preventive care and early diagnosis is also contributing to higher treatment rates.
Europe follows closely, with countries such as the UK, Germany, and France experiencing growing demand for VTE treatment solutions due to their aging populations and robust healthcare systems.
The Asia-Pacific region is expected to witness the highest growth during the forecast period, supported by increasing healthcare investments, rising awareness of VTE, and the expansion of medical infrastructure in countries like China, India, and Japan.
